Vodafone marks 10 years in mobile money service

After 10 years of progression in the mobile money service, Vodafone finally marks the 10th anniversary of M-Pesa as the world’s leading service. It has been revealed that a record 614 million M-pesa transactions were processed last year, December 2016.

Vodafone has tremendously grown that it now offers M-pesa in 10 countries: India, Albania, the Democratic Republic of Congo, Egypt, Ghana, Kenya, Lesotho, Mozambique, Romania and Tanzania. By the end of December 2016, M-pesa had served almost 29.5 million active customers through a network of more than 287,400 agents.

The service was designed to enable customers to transact safely and securely to send, receive and store money via a basic mobile phone and, more recently in some markets, using a smartphone app.
Customers can visit an M-Pesa agent to top up their M-Pesa account and can use their mobile phone to pay for bills, shop or send money to other users.
M-Pesa has also helped reduce the potential risks of street robbery, burglary and petty corruption within cash-based economies where people are limited.
So far, only a small proportion of the population benefit from access to conventional financial services. M-Pesa has been a great initiative that has empowered tens of millions of people in the poorest communities in the world to start and gown businesses and gain greater financial resilience.
